About the Course

This course serves as a reminder that you are making a difference as a teacher, in both small and significant ways. Day in and day out, you are changing lives. Because of a Teacher is a compilation of stories dedicated to teachers past, present, and future. Whether you’re a first-year teacher or 30 years deep, this course will help you remember why you chose this profession and uplift you during the difficult times of burnout and exhaustion. These stories will warm your heart, have you nodding along, and make you feel seen. This is a must-read for any educator!

Teachers will actively participate in online learning to further develop their understanding of the power of connection and building relationships. Teachers will discuss and reflect on giving students ownership in their learning, the role of a school’s culture, the strength of feedback, and the importance of self-care. Teachers will engage in thorough reflection and discourse with other teachers. 

This course is appropriate for anyone who serves students and needs a reminder that the work they are doing is powerful. It matters.

Upon completion of this course, the student will be able to:

  • Explain the significance of connection and relationship building inside and outside of the classroom.
  • Establish a classroom culture that is welcoming and safe for all students. 
  • Analyze the importance of self-care and setting boundaries. 
  • Advocate and ask for help from colleagues and leverage support within their school community.
  • Examine how the power of great teachers and great administrators can change the trajectory of any student.

Facilitator

Michelle Hagerman

Michelle Hagerman is currently an elementary school teacher in Mesa County, Grand Junction. She has taught 5th grade and 3rd grade at the same school in Mesa County. She has 10 years of education under her belt. However, her journey of helping kids began as she learned alongside her mother, who ran a summer school in Hawai'i, where Michelle was born and raised. At an early age, she was supporting students inside and outside the classroom. She has forever had a passion for helping students succeed academically as well as socially and emotionally. 

Michelle has developed CO Pilot classes around the demands of being a teacher nowadays, with the heart of focusing on students' and teachers' emotional well-being. She recognizes the impact as well as the workload teachers as asked to do day-in-and-day-out. Her why for being a facilitator for CO Pilot is around the essence that teachers need to know their work matters, they are changing lives, and that they feel seen. She is constantly in the know about new websites, book studies, and techniques to help support students and teachers inside and outside of the classroom. 

Michelle holds a BA in Elementary Education from Colorado Mesa University and an M.A. in Educational Leadership and Policy Studies from the University of Northern Colorado.
